The United States has not entirely ignored the suffering in Darfur. Over three years of genocide, our government has sent close to $800 million in humanitarian aid to refugees, given a modicum of support to African Union (AU) peacekeepers, and occasionally pushed—though not necessarily enforced—punitive resolutions at the United Nations. By the standards of the international community, this counts as a robust response. READ MORE >>
